An Advanced Skill Certificate in Water Conservation Conflict Management equips professionals with the expertise to navigate complex water resource challenges. The program emphasizes practical, real-world applications of conflict resolution techniques within the context of water scarcity and management.
Learning outcomes include mastering negotiation strategies, mediation techniques, and collaborative problem-solving approaches specifically designed for water-related disputes. Participants gain a deep understanding of water governance, policy analysis, and stakeholder engagement. The curriculum also covers sustainable water management practices and environmental law relevant to water resource conflicts.
